Most of us get into negative habits with email: we check our messages each and every handful of minutes, study them and feel vaguely stressed about them, but take small or no action, so they pile up into an even a lot more pressure-inducing heap. Instead, Mann advised his audience that day at Google's Silicon Valley campus, each and every time you visit your inbox, you need to systematically approach to zero". Clarify the action each and Recommended Reading every message requires - a reply, an entry on your to-do list, or just filing it away. Carry out that action. Repeat till no emails stay.
